    Get 50% off The Darkened Sea expansion now through Wednesday, September 30, 2015 at 11:59PM PDT*.

    [IMG]

    In addition, this content is also available for Daybreak Cash during this promotion! Note that the 50% off promotion does not apply to the Daybreak Cash payment method. The Daybreak Cash payment method will be visible to you at the end of the check-out process (on the same page where you can choose to pay with credit card or PayPal).

    If you’re an All-Access member, note that you get an ADDITIONAL 10% off these purchases. If you’re not current an All-Access member (or want to see what else members get), you can sign up for membership here.

    The Darkened Sea Collector’s Edition will sail off into the sunset when this promotion ends. Don’t miss your last chance to pick up this collector’s edition, and get the special items included with this purchase! You can get to the expansion purchase page here.

  14. Aurastrider Augur

    To those wondering if this includes COTF yes it does. When ever you buy the last expansion released you are granted all the previous expansions. When they switch to a campaign model that might change.
